FREEZING WORKS STRIKE.
COURT IMPOSES FTSTES. (B7 Telegraph.—Press Association.) WANXJANtn, this day. In connection with the recent rtrike by the'imlay Freezing Works slaughtermen two of the strikers were to-day fined £10 each and a number of others £5 each. The men made a demand for increased wages and then knoc-ked oir work, alleging that the sheep .vero \vet. j -
